Congress leader and former Rajya Sabha MP V Hanumantha Rao slammed the BJP-led government by alleging that the saffron party was behind the controversy of remark over Prophet Muhammad by party spokesperson Nupur Sharma.


 “There is a ‘conspiracy’ by the BJP government at the Centre behind the controversial remarks by Nupur Sharma,” Rao said.


While commenting on the condemnation coming from Gulf countries, he said, “Already the Arab Countries like Qatar, Kuwait, Iran, Saudi Arabia, and Bahrain strongly condemned the BJP government and complained to the United Nations. The Arab nations have already boycotted the Indian-made products.”


The Congress leader also said that the suspension of Nupur Sharma from the party is not the solution.


“With their controversial remarks against Prophet Mohammed, a lot of damage was caused to our country at the international level. BJP leaders like Nupur Sharma and Naveen Jindal should be arrested immediately. It is all part of making India a Hindu raj. What will be the fate of the Indian youth working in Arab countries? The Indian employees in those countries are being kicked out back to our country because of the actions of BJP leaders,” he added.
